Meghalaya is witnessing nearly 900 new HIV cases annually, prompting the government to launch an urgent action plan. Health Minister Ampareen Lyngdoh has called for mass awareness, early detection, and community mobilisation to combat what she termed a threat to the state’s social fabric and well-being.
